Jeanne Marie envisions a continent transformed through effective, principled leadership. She believes that meaningful change in Africa depends on leaders who can guide others, support their teams, and implement visions at every level.
She is passionate about strengthening organizations, churches, and communities by cultivating leaders who can accompany and empower those around them to achieve sustainable impact.
Jeanne Marie’s Christian faith has shaped her calling and approach to leadership. Having committed her life to Christ while at university, she has consistently seen God’s hand guiding her journey. From leading prayer sessions to serving on her church council and General Assembly, she has developed a servant-leadership approach, combining responsibility with compassion. Her faith motivates her to mentor, inspire, and equip others, ensuring that her work uplifts individuals and communities with integrity and purpose.
Her personal and professional experiences have reinforced her leadership abilities. As the eldest of five children and the only daughter, she naturally took on leadership responsibilities early, later serving as class delegate, founding an association to support children affected by HIV, and today serving with Population Services International as Program Director for HIV/AIDs prevention. She is applying to the Abundant Leadership Institute to sharpen her leadership skills, learn from experienced mentors, and deepen her ability to guide teams and communities toward transformation in Burundi and beyond.
